TravelNurseSource is working with Cynet Health to find a qualified Med/Surg / Tele RN in Lees Summit, Missouri, 64086!

Job Title: Registered Nurse Profession: Nursing Specialty: Med/Surg/Telemetry Duration: 13 weeks Shift: Night Hours per Shift: 12 Experience: Minimum 2 years License: Active Nursing License required Certifications: BLS, NIHSS Must-Have: Telemetry experience Ability to interpret dysrhythmias Experience with cardiac telemetry Management of dysrhythmias Telemetry unit monitoring Description: The position requires a registered nurse with experience in Med/Surg and Telemetry. The daily census is approximately 29 patients with 30 rooms available. The nurse will be responsible for monitoring patients and performing necessary interventions. Qualifications include the ability to manage and administer blood products, central line care and management, and heparin protocols. Experience with IV start and maintenance is essential. The nurse will be responsible for tracheostomy care and management as well as wound care. Additional responsibilities include working with rapid response and code teams. The nurse should also be familiar with managing patients who have undergone total joint replacements and those suffering from sepsis or cardiac arrhythmias. The role may involve floating within the service line and to sister facilities as needed. Weekend coverage is required, with 4-6 shifts every 6 weeks. Patients primarily consist of adults and geriatrics. The nurse will work closely with interdisciplinary teams, including physical therapy, respiratory services, and social services. A collaborative approach to patient care is essential.
